The RMS International Scientific Imaging Competition 2021 is now open for entries showcasing the very best in microscopy and imaging.
As with previous competitions, a gallery of shortlisted images will be displayed and judged as part of the Microscience Microscopy Congress (mmc) 2021, taking place as an online event from 5 – 9 July.
The competition is open to images in both life and materials science, captured by a huge range of microscopical techniques. A regular fixture of major RMS events since 1958, the competition features some of the finest examples of scientific imaging and artistic flair from right across the many fields of microscopy.
This year, the categories are as follows:
Electron Microscopy - Life Sciences
Electron Microscopy - Physical Sciences
Light Microscopy - Life Sciences
Light Microscopy - Physical Sciences
AFM and Scanning Probe Microscopies
Short Video
Other
If you have a striking image (or images) of which you are proud, and would like to take the opportunity to share your work with delegates at mmc2021, please submit your entry(ies) online by 10 May 2021.
